Q: Is 4,240,158 a Prime Number?

 A: No, 4,240,158 is not a prime number.

Why is 4,240,158 not a prime number?

A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.

The number 4240158 can be evenly divided by 1 2 3 6 13 26 39 78 54,361 108,722 163,083 326,166 706,693 1,413,386 2,120,079 and 4,240,158, with no remainder.

Since 4,240,158 cannot be divided by just 1 and 4,240,158, it is not a prime number.
